Source: colord-kde
Version: 25.04.0-1
Severity: important
From a very brief look at the colord-kde code, it appears like when
colord-kde was first created, it had an optional dependency on gnome-color-manager for color calibration. By 2013, colord-kde was
able to handle this itself. Therefore, I think the gnome-color-manager dependency is no longer needed.
The Debian GNOME team is likely to remove gnome-color-manager from
Debian since it is unmaintained upstream and no longer used in GNOME.
This might happen in time for trixie. I'm filing a blocks bug in a
moment with more details.
